SUMMARY
Using the "Filter" (`Ctrl-i`) when in "Selection Mode", will remove any
selection. It would be so much more useful if the selection would be remembered
between multiple filtering. Not only would an accidentally use of filter
(either you don't know or forgot like me) delete the current complex selection,
this would also enable us to actually use the filter in the selection mode.
ST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Enter "Selection Mode" (`Space`).
2. Click a few different files.
3. Open the "Filter" bar (`Ctrl-i`).
4. Type a few letters to filter the current view in a way, that the previously
selected files are not longer visible.
5. Clear the filter (`ESC`).
OBSERVED RESULT
The previously selected files are no longer selected.
EXPECTED RESULT
Remember the previous selected items/files that were hidden because of use of
filter.
